Understanding Ski Accident Responsibility and Colorado Ski Safety Laws

Colorado has specific regulations regulating ski resort mishaps and the liability of ski hotels, various other skiers, and equipment makers. Understanding these regulations is vital when seeking a ski accident case. Colorado's ski security laws outline the duties of both skiers and resorts, including what constitutes carelessness on the inclines. When a skier goes against these safety criteria and triggers an accident, they might be held liable for injuries and problems arising from their careless behavior.

One of the most essential aspects of Colorado ski regulation is the concept of "assumption of danger." While skiers do assume certain inherent risks related to the sporting activity, this doesn't mean resorts and various other skiers can act with complete disregard Cheney Galluzzi and Howard for security. Hotel drivers have a lawful responsibility to maintain safe problems, effectively mark threats, and implement safety and security regulations. In a similar way, other skiers have a task to ski properly and avoid colliding with others. When these responsibilities are breached, injured parties may have premises for a ski accident lawsuit.

Colorado regulation additionally gives a two-year statute of restrictions for filing a ski accident lawsuit, suggesting you have 2 years from the day of your injury to take legal action. This timeline is vital, as proof can be shed and witnesses' memories can discolor in time. In addition, Colorado adheres to a "changed comparative negligence" regulation, which implies that also if you birth some duty for the accident, you might still recoup problems as long as you're not more than 50% liable. Preventing Future Ski Accidents: Safety And Security Tips for Denver Skiers and Snowboarders

While our primary focus is helping injured skiers recoup payment for their injuries, we're also passionate about protecting against future ski mishaps. Comprehending typical causes of ski accidents and taking appropriate security preventative measures can substantially minimize your risk of injury on the slopes. Among the most essential safety and security methods is snowboarding within your capacity degree. Skiers and snowboarders must always stay on slopes suitable for their ability level and prevent trying runs that are beyond their capacities. Overestimating your abilities is an usual source of ski accidents that cause serious injuries.

Proper tools is essential for ski safety and security. Your skis or snowboard must be effectively fitted and kept, with bindings gotten used to launch suitably in a fall. Helmets are critical safety equipment that can dramatically lower the danger of head injuries, which are amongst the most severe injuries sustained in ski crashes. Several ski resorts currently need safety helmets for youngsters, and all skiers need to think about using one regardless of age or experience degree. Additionally, putting on suitable clothes for the weather conditions and guaranteeing you're appropriately hydrated and relaxed prior to heading to the inclines are important safety and security considerations.

Following ski resort security rules and appreciating the Skier's Responsibility Code is basic to stop accidents. The Skier's Obligation Code describes basic security concepts, including the duty to stay in control, to avoid barriers and other individuals, to yield to skiers in advance of you, and to ski responsibly on inclines suitable for your ability. Staying clear of alcohol and medicines while winter sports is vital, as impairment dramatically enhances the danger of crashes. Furthermore, understanding weather and slope problems, such as icy spots or moguls, can assist you browse the hill safely.
